Greenville, NC – East Carolina University Soccer and Football Teams Face Tough Competitions

As the 2025 sports season heats up, East Carolina University (ECU) is facing challenging competitions with both its soccer and football teams. The ECU soccer team recorded one win, two draws, and two losses (1-2-2) before a competitive match against the University of North Carolina Wilmington (UNCW) on August 28, 2025. Conversely, UNCW entered the game with a record of two wins, two draws, and one loss (2-2-1).

In their match, ECU’s Caitlen-Star Dolan Boodram made a significant impact by scoring a goal at the 53:37 mark, assisted by teammates Holly Schlagel and Amy Mason. However, in a dramatic turn of events, UNCW’s Allie Planeaux successfully converted a penalty kick goal in the final minutes, specifically at 89:13, which resulted in a 1-1 draw against ECU. This match highlighted the tenacity and competitiveness of both teams.

As the soccer team completed its match, the ECU football team was set to kick off its season against NC State on August 29, 2025. The excitement surrounding this match was palpable as ECU entered the game trailing with a preliminary score of 0-1 following a 29-yard field goal by NC State’s Nick Koniecznski.

NC State continued to build its lead after scoring a touchdown with CJ Bailey running for 11 yards, extending the score to 0-10. The momentum remained with NC State as they added a 48-yard touchdown pass from CJ Bailey to Wesley Grimes, pushing the score to 0-17. With ECU under pressure, they managed to respond with a 79-yard touchdown pass from Katin Houser to Jayvontay Conner, reducing the score to 7-17.

Despite ECU’s attempts to rally, NC State maintained its offensive pressure by scoring through Hollywood Smothers, who rushed for a 2-yard touchdown, thereby extending the lead to 24-17. The ECU squad remained determined, with Marlon Gunn Jr. achieving a 4-yard rushing touchdown to bring the score to 14-24. Finally, ECU’s Nick Mazzie added a 34-yard field goal, resulting in a final score of 17 for ECU and 24 for NC State.
